SIG Sauer Unveils the OSCAR6 HDX PRO Spotting Scope
Author: Aleksa M. | Publish Date: Jun 27, 2025 | Fact checked by: Marko Lalovic
SIG Sauer has introduced what they're calling a revolutionary advancement in optics technology with the launch of their OSCAR6 HDX PRO spotting scope. This cutting-edge optical device represents a significant leap forward in image stabilization technology, specifically designed to meet the demanding needs of professional shooters and hunters who require exceptional clarity and precision in the field.

Advanced Optical Design and Performance
The OSCAR6 HDX PRO showcases SIG Sauer's commitment to optical excellence through its sophisticated engineering. Built around a roof prism configuration, this spotting scope delivers exceptional image quality through its variable magnification system ranging from 16x to 32x magnification, paired with a generous 60mm objective lens that maximizes light gathering capability.
The scope's optical foundation is built upon HDX glass technology, which provides superior clarity and light transmission. What truly sets this spotting scope apart is its integration of SIG's proprietary Optical Image Stabilization technology, creating a viewing experience that remains steady even in challenging field conditions.
Key Optical Specifications
The OSCAR6 HDX PRO's optical performance is defined by several critical specifications that directly impact user experience in the field. The eye relief measurement varies from 22mm at lower magnification to 16mm at higher magnification settings, accommodating different shooting positions and eyewear configurations. The field of view spans an impressive range from 2.4 to 3.4 degrees, providing adequate coverage for target acquisition and observation.
One particularly noteworthy feature is the minimum focusing distance of just 5 meters, making this spotting scope versatile for both long-range observation and closer-range applications. The second focal plane design ensures consistent reticle appearance across the entire magnification range, which is particularly beneficial for varied lighting and distance conditions.

Revolutionary Image Stabilization Technology
OmniScan™ Optical Image Stabilization
At the heart of the OSCAR6 HDX PRO lies SIG Sauer's breakthrough OmniScan™ Optical Image Stabilization technology. This advanced system utilizes a sophisticated digital accelerometer that continuously monitors user movement and environmental vibrations, automatically adjusting the level of correction to maintain a stable image.
The system's intelligence lies in its ability to differentiate between intentional movements and unwanted vibrations, providing precise compensation that enhances image clarity without interfering with natural tracking motions. This technology proves especially valuable during extended observation sessions or when shooting from unstable positions.
Image Compensation Features
The OSCAR6 HDX PRO incorporates a 0° image compensation angle, ensuring that the viewed image maintains proper orientation regardless of the scope's position. This feature eliminates the disorientation that can occur with traditional spotting scopes when used at various angles, making it more intuitive for users to maintain situational awareness.

Premium Coating Systems and Durability
Advanced Lens Protection
SIG Sauer has equipped the OSCAR6 HDX PRO with a comprehensive suite of protective coatings designed to ensure optimal performance in harsh environmental conditions. The SpectraCoat™ technology enhances light transmission while reducing unwanted reflections, contributing to the scope's exceptional image quality.
Lens Armor™ coating provides additional protection against scratches and abrasions that can occur during field use, while the HDX PRO coatings significantly enhance light transmission and reduce glare. The Lens Shield™ technology adds another layer of protection, ensuring that the optical elements remain clear and functional even in challenging weather conditions.
Weather Protection and Build Quality
The spotting scope meets IPX7 waterproof standards, providing confidence in wet weather conditions and ensuring internal components remain protected from moisture ingress. The fogproof performance guarantees clear optics across temperature variations, preventing internal fogging that could compromise visibility during critical moments.
Physical Design and Mounting Options
Construction and Ergonomics
The OSCAR6 HDX PRO measures 11.5 inches in overall length and weighs 55.2 ounces with batteries installed, striking a balance between portability and optical performance. The scope comes finished in Flat Dark Earth (FDE), providing a professional appearance that blends well with tactical and hunting environments.
Mounting System
Professional users will appreciate the integrated ARCA-SWISS tripod mount, which provides seamless compatibility with professional-grade tripod heads. This built-in mounting system eliminates the need for additional adapters and ensures a secure, stable platform for extended observation sessions.
Power and Operational Features
Battery Performance
The OSCAR6 HDX PRO operates on two AA alkaline batteries, providing up to 50 hours of continuous runtime. This impressive battery life ensures that the image stabilization system remains operational throughout extended field sessions without frequent battery changes.
Included Accessories
SIG Sauer has included a comprehensive accessory package with the OSCAR6 HDX PRO. The kit includes a hand strap for secure carrying, a molded EVA foam case for protection during transport and storage, a removable sunshade to reduce glare in bright conditions, and a rubber eyecup for comfortable extended viewing sessions.

Pricing and Availability
The SIG Sauer OSCAR6 HDX PRO Image-Stabilized Spotting Scope is available at a retail price of $1,999.99, positioning it as a premium optical solution for users who require the ultimate in spotting scope performance and reliability.
